A body is moving with an acceleration of 60 m/s2. If the force applied to t
body is 42000 N, calculate its mass

Respuesta :

ChoiSungHyun
ChoiSungHyun ChoiSungHyun
  • 30-12-2020

Explanation:

Fnet = ma

m = Fnet/a = 42,000N/(60m/s²) = 700kg.
